Crawlspace Foundation Repair in Boulder, CO
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ues that affect the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ation beneath the home. These projects often involve fixing sagging or uneven floors, repairing or replacing damaged support beams, and sealing or insulating the crawlspace to prevent moisture intrusion. Property owners typically seek these services when noticing signs such as cracks in walls, musty odors, or pest activity, which can indicate underlying foundation problems or moisture concerns that require attention.
Before requesting crawlspace foundation repair,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the work needed, including whether structural reinforcement or moisture mitigation is necessary. It’s important to consider the current condition of the crawlspace, the extent of damage, and any potential impacts on the overall stability of the home. Clarifying these details can help property owners make informed decisions about repairs and ensure the foundation remains sound for years to come.

Common Crawlspace Foundation Repair Jobs
Crawlspace foundation repair involves stabilizing and leveling the foundation to prevent settling and shifting.
Moisture control helps reduce mold growth and wood rot by sealing and waterproofing crawlspaces.
Vapor barrier installation prevents ground moisture from entering the crawlspace environment.
Structural reinforcement addresses sagging beams and supports to maintain the integrity of the foundation.
Pest prevention includes sealing entry points and removing debris to keep pests out of the crawlspace.
Drainage solutions improve water flow around the foundation to reduce water-related damage.
Crawlspace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, cracks in walls, or persistent moisture and musty odors in the home.
Why is it important to repair a crawlspace foundation? Addressing foundation problems helps prevent structural damage, mold growth, and further deterioration of the property.
What types of repairs are common for crawlspace foundations? Common fixes include installing support piers, sealing vents, and reinforcing or replacing damaged beams and posts.
How can I prevent future crawlspace problems? Proper ventilation, moisture control, and regular inspections can help maintain a healthy crawlspace environment.
